You are qualified to retire from active duty after finishing 20 years of reputable service. The retirement pay you receive from the Army is identified by your service period and rank, particularly by computing the average of your leading 36 months of fundamental pay.

There are 2 pension strategies for active task service members. These consist of: The Legacy or High 36 Retirement SystemBlended Retirement System (BRS)Both strategies require 20 or more years of service. The quantity you get from each plan is also based on the quantity you earned from your standard pay and the date you signed up with the military.
